Basic Responsibilities

The Moon Transportation Authority (MTA) was established in 1987 to promote economic and infrastructure development in Moon Township. Since its inception, the MTA has financed and constructed three new interchanges and several connector roads along Interstate Business Loop 376. Each project has enhanced the transportation network in Moon Township and opened hundreds of acres of land for development.

The MTA Board consists of five (5) members appointed by the Board of Supervisors. Two members are recommended by the Moon Area School District, two members are from the Board of Supervisors, and one member is appointed to represent the Moon Township business community.
